We are a private alternative school serving PreK through 8th grade, dedicated to providing personalized education in small classes of just 8 students.
Our approach integrates a growth mindset, action-centered practice, and outdoor learning with individualized academics, helping our students exceed grade-level standards.

- Here at All-Star Academy, we partner with parents, and any preferred providers, to deliver a personalized, exceptional education to their child. We recruit the most talented teachers that can customize learning plans and supersede behavioral or learning challenges.
- Our mission is to drive a new era of education where parents have influence and each student is challenged in a holistic manner to create a fully competent, capable, and creative member of society.
